SeaOasis: Floating Aquaculture for Smallholders' Global Food Security
English | 2022 | ISBN: 9811913722 | 68 Pages | PDF (True) | 12 MB
This book highlights a research-based design proposal which has the purpose of relieving from lack of global food supply. Due to the current overuse of land, it suggests an extension of aquatic food production with floating devices onto the sea. These devices are called SeaOasis because they function as an oasis as closed-loop systems and are therefore highly sustainable.
